After the recent deaths of two aspirants in Mumbai, now a 27-year-old youth from Sangamner, Tushar Baban Bhalke, has passed away while participating in the physical tests at the Police Ground in Shivajinagar.

According to reports, Tushar collapsed while running at around 8 am and was immediately rushed to Sassoon Hospital for treatment. Despite efforts to save him, his blood pressure dropped during treatment, leading to his untimely demise. It is believed that Tushar may have suffered a fatal heart attack during the run.

This unfortunate incident has once again raised concerns about the physical demands and stress of the Police Recruitment process. Our thoughts are with Tushar’s family and friends during this difficult time.
